Worth it?

This app is really good so far and looks like it has some cool features in the subscription-side. Having said that, it will only offer DTL analysis and they take a REALLY long time (with the free version, at least), and for $30/month, I don’t know if it’s worth it.
Even then, I would love to see the subscription plan be more in the $15-20 range. People are fed up with subscription models and their current subscription is likely going to price a lot of people out.

Don’t expect custom AI advice - very generic

I have been overall disappointed. The AI images are cool but not useful. So the AI says my hands are “too in”. OK, why? They gave me 8 potential reasons! If this were a truly useful app it would discern exactly what I am doing wrong (like my golf instructor) not give me a laundry list of potential reasons. The drills they give you are helpful but you can get all that for free on YouTube. With further development of the generative AI model this could be useful but at this point way too generic. Also the scoring is highly variable (as others have pointed out).
